This chapter, and pretty much every chapter after this, deals with object-oriented Python programming. Remember when I said you should know an object-oriented language to read this book? Well, I wasn't kidding.
Here is a complete, working Python program. Read the doc strings to get an overview of what it does and how it works. As usual, don't worry about the stuff you don't understand; that's what the rest of the chapter is for.
"""Framework for getting file information, including filetype-specific metadata.
Instantiate appropriate class with filename to get metadata. Returned object
acts just like a dictionary, with key-value pairs for each piece of metadata.
import fileinfo
info = fileinfo.MP3FileInfo("/music/ap/mahadeva.mp3")
print "\\n".join(["%s=%s" % (k, info[k]) for k in info.keys()])
Or use listDirectory function to get info on all files in a directory.
infoList = fileinfo.listDirectory("/music/ap/", [".mp3"])
for info in infoList:
...
Framework can be extended by adding classes for particular file types, e.g.
HTMLFileInfo, MPGFileInfo, DOCFileInfo. Each class is completely responsible for
parsing its files appropriately; see MP3FileInfo for example.
"""
import os
from UserDict import UserDict
class FileInfo(UserDict):
"base class for file info"
def __init__(self, filename=None):
UserDict.__init__(self)
self["name"] = filename
class MP3FileInfo(FileInfo):
"class for MP3 file info, including ID3v1.0 tags if found"
def __normalize(self, data):
"strip whitespace and nulls"
return data.replace("\00", " ").strip()
def __parse(self, filename):
"parse ID3v1.0 tags from MP3 file"
self.clear()
try:
fsock = open(filename, "rb", 0)
try:
fsock.seek(-128, 2)
tagdata = fsock.read(128)
finally:
fsock.close()
if tagdata[:3] == 'TAG':
self["title"] = self.__normalize(tagdata[3:33])
self["artist"] = self.__normalize(tagdata[33:63])
self["album"] = self.__normalize(tagdata[63:93])
self["year"] = self.__normalize(tagdata[93:97])
self["comment"] = self.__normalize(tagdata[97:126])
self["genre"] = ord(tagdata[127])
except IOError:
pass
def __setitem__(self, key, item):
if key == "name" and item:
self.__parse(item)
FileInfo.__setitem__(self, key, item)
def __getFileInfoObjectClass(filename):
"get file info class from filename extension, returns class"
subclass = "%sFileInfo" % os.path.splitext(filename)[1].upper()[1:]
if globals().has_key(subclass):
return eval(subclass)
else:
return FileInfo
def listDirectory(directory, fileExtList):
"return list of file info objects for files of particular extensions"
fileExtList = [ext.upper() for ext in fileExtList]
fileList = [os.path.join(directory, f) for f in os.listdir(directory) \
if os.path.splitext(f)[1].upper() in fileExtList]
return [__getFileInfoObjectClass(f)(f) for f in fileList]
if __name__ == "__main__":
for info in listDirectory("/music/_singles/", [".mp3"]):
for key, value in info.items():
print "%s=%s" % (key, value)
print| This program's output depends on the files on your hard drive. To get meaningful output, you'll have to change the directory path to point to a directory of MP3 files on your own machine. |
Example 3.2. Output of fileinfo.py
This was the output I got on my machine. Your output will be different, unless, by some startling coincidence, you share my exact taste in music.
